Engaging Women in Planned Giving
You’ve seen the statistics: Today’s women are an active financial force—they earn, manage and distribute more wealth than ever before. Their importance as planned giving prospects shouldn’t be forgotten as it will continue to grow. Participants will learn how and why a woman’s approach to philanthropy can be different from that of a man, as well as where to spend time and money when targeting women. Through a selection of case studies that brought success to the Texas A&M Foundation’s planned giving program, Ms. Throne will convey practical ideas that can be implemented quickly and cost-effectively.
